Cost of Porch Enlargement in San Angelo
Enlarging your porch in San Angelo, TX, can significantly enhance your home's curb appeal and provide additional outdoor living space. Understanding the various factors that influence the cost and the common tasks involved can help you budget effectively for this home improvement project.
Factors Affecting Cost
- Size of Enlargement: Larger porches require more materials and labor, increasing the overall cost.
- Materials Used: Choice of materials, such as wood, composite, or concrete, can significantly impact the price.
- Design Complexity: Intricate designs with custom features will cost more than simple, straightforward designs.
- Labor Costs: Labor rates in San Angelo, TX, can vary, influencing the total project cost.
- Permits and Inspections: Local regulations may require permits and inspections, adding to the expense.
- Site Preparation: The condition of the existing site and the amount of preparation needed can affect costs.
- Utilities and Lighting: Adding electrical outlets, lighting, or other utilities will increase the budget.
Average Costs for Common Tasks
Task | Average Cost (San Angelo, TX) |
---|---|
Basic Porch Enlargement | $5,000 - $10,000 |
Premium Materials (e.g., composite) | $8,000 - $15,000 |
Custom Design Features | $2,000 - $5,000 |
Labor (per hour) | $50 - $75 |
Permits and Inspections | $200 - $500 |
Site Preparation | $500 - $2,000 |
Electrical Work | $100 - $300 per outlet |
Lighting Installation | $150 - $500 per fixture |
